WebMisfire. Whenever you make an attack roll with a firearm, and the dice roll is. equal to or lower than the weapon’s Misfire score, the weapon misfires. The attack misses, and the … WebThe chance of misfire increases by 1 if the player firing the gun does not have proficiency in firearms.
